flaky-test-audit scanned grade A with 0 findings against 26 rules in 11 categories — prompt injection, anti-refusal, data exfiltration, privilege escalation, supply chain, agent snooping, system-prompt leakage, SSRF and excessive agency — measured 2d ago.
A static scan of the body, not an audit. Every finding is printed with the line that produced it so you can judge whether it matters here. A mod is markdown that instructs an agent; that is exactly why what it instructs is worth reading.
Nothing flagged
None of the 26 patterns this scan looks for appear in this file: no shell pipes, no recursive deletes, no credential paths, no hidden text, no instruction-override or anti-refusal phrasing, no agent-config snooping. That is not a guarantee, it is the absence of the things that are checkable.

flaky-test-audit — measure flakiness, don't guess it
A test is flaky when it passes and fails on the same code. That is a number: run it N times, count the failures, and any test with a rate strictly between 0 and 1 is flaky by definition. The flag itself is computation, not judgement.
When to use
- A test "sometimes fails" and you want it confirmed and quantified.
- Periodic test-health sweep (nightly / weekly) that escalates only when a new test turns flaky.
Process
-
Detect the framework and pick a per-test invocation — see
reference/framework-adapters.md. The unit of work is aresults.jsonmappingtest -> {"runs", "fails"}. -
Run repeatedly. For a single suspect test, or a loop over test ids:
FLAKE_TEST_NAME="<test-id>" \ "${CLAUDE_PLUGIN_ROOT}"/skills/flaky-test-audit/scripts/flake_runner.sh 10 results.json <test-command>Pass the test id verbatim — the runner JSON-escapes it, so an id carrying quotes or backslashes still keys valid JSON. Or produce
results.jsondirectly from a framework's JSON reporter aggregated across N runs (adapters doc). -
Compute the rate:
python3 "${CLAUDE_PLUGIN_ROOT}"/skills/flaky-test-audit/scripts/compute_flakiness.py \ results.json prev-quarantine.json quarantine.jsonIt prints a sorted
FLAKY fails/runs rate testtable, writesquarantine.jsonfor every0 < rate < 1test, and exits with the count of tests newly flaky sinceprev-quarantine.json, capped at 250. Exit 1-250 = a scheduled routine escalates; 0 = no new flake, stay quiet.The codes above the cap are tool failures rather than counts: 251 a bad invocation, 252 a
results.jsonor baseline file that is missing, unparseable or not shaped{test: {runs, fails}}, 253 aquarantine.jsonthat could not be written. 251 and 252 write noquarantine.json, so a sweep that never parsed cannot be read as a clean one. Aprev-quarantine.jsonthat does not exist yet is the first sweep, not an error.
